首页
/ go-search-extension 项目亮点解析

go-search-extension 项目亮点解析

2025-04-26 12:07:59作者:乔或婵

1. 项目的基础介绍

go-search-extension 是一个使用 Go 语言开发的浏览器搜索扩展项目。该项目旨在为用户提供一个快速、高效的搜索工具,通过浏览器扩展的形式,实现对网页内容的快速检索,提高用户的信息检索效率。

2. 项目代码目录及介绍

项目的代码目录结构清晰,主要包括以下几个部分:

  • src/:存放项目的源代码。
    • main.go:项目的入口文件,包含扩展的主要逻辑。
    • popup.html:浏览器扩展的用户界面。
    • background.js:后台脚本,处理扩展的背景任务。
  • manifest.json:描述扩展的元数据,如名称、版本、权限等。
  • test/:存放测试相关的代码。
  • README.md:项目的说明文档。

3. 项目亮点功能拆解

go-search-extension 项目的主要亮点功能包括:

  • 快速搜索:通过浏览器扩展,用户可以快速调用搜索功能,无需打开新的页面或应用。
  • 自定义搜索:用户可以根据自己的需求,添加或修改搜索源,实现个性化搜索。
  • 智能提示:在输入搜索关键字时,扩展会智能提示相关词汇,提高搜索效率。

4. 项目主要技术亮点拆解

该项目的技术亮点主要体现在以下方面:

  • Go 语言开发:使用 Go 语言进行开发,保证了扩展的性能和稳定性。
  • 模块化设计:项目采用模块化设计,使得代码易于维护和扩展。
  • 跨平台兼容:扩展兼容主流浏览器,如 Chrome、Firefox 等。

5. 与同类项目对比的亮点

相比于其他同类项目,go-search-extension 的亮点在于:

  • 性能优化:由于采用 Go 语言,项目在执行效率上具有优势。
  • 自定义性强:用户可以根据自己的需求进行个性化设置,提升使用体验。
  • 社区活跃:项目在 GitHub 上拥有活跃的开发者社区,持续更新和维护。
登录后查看全文
热门项目推荐